Confirmed. "System Settings - Display" don't work for
dual-head (at least
here). All I get when clicking the multi-monitor module is a message:
"This module is only for configuring systems with a single desktop spread
across multiple monitors. You do not appear to have this configuration."
Note that using "xrandr --output VGA1 --right-of LVDS1" or Arandr works like
a charm.
You said that you're using intel graphics?
As far as I know for F11 there is a huge difference between 965 and
newer chipsets vs. everything else (8xx etc.).
So if you're using an 8xx chipset there is a good chance that stuff will
just work once F12 is released as the new intel driver (in combination
with the new kernel) fixes a lot of issues with those chips.
